Etude pilote pour la mise en place d’un outil de biomonitoring en milieu marin dans le cadre de la mise en place de la Directive Cadre Eau à la Réunion. Programme MODIOLE (2004-2008) ArchiMer
Cambert, Harold; Gonzalez, Jean-louis; Andral, Bruno; Turquet, Jean.
La mesure directe des contaminants dans l'eau fait appel à des techniques analytiques sophistiquées et coûteuses, difficilement applicables à de nombreux échantillons prélevés le long d'un important linéaire côtier. Par ailleurs, la variabilité du milieu littoral confère une représentativité limitée à une mesure ponctuelle effectuée dans la colonne d’eau. Le biomonitoring utilisant la moule repose sur l’hypothèse que le contenu en contaminant dans la chair de cet animal reflète la concentration en contaminants biodisponibles dans l’eau sous forme particulaire et/ou dissoute, selon un processus de bioaccumulation. Cette hypothèse a été validée pour les substances chimiques de type hydrophobe ou intermédiaire, susceptibles de se bioaccumuler et caractérisées...

In situ kinetics of mercury bioaccumulation in mytilus galloprovincialis estimated by transplantation experiments ArchiMer
Casas, Stellio; Cossa, Daniel; Gonzalez, Jean-louis; Bacher, Cedric; Andral, Bruno.
Monitoring coastal contamination by trace metals pollution using mollusks bivalves as quantitative bioindicators is widely performed in many international biomonitoring programs. For this purpose, studying mercury dynamic in marine mussels is a reliable tool. In situ experiments on uptake and elimination kinetics were conducted in three Mediterranean sites, chosen on the basis of their contamination levels. Mussels were transplanted from a clean area to a highly contaminated one and then transferred back to a clean site. This approach makes it possible to define bioaccumulation factors and uptake and elimination rates consistently with the real environmental conditions.

Influence des rejets urbains sur la contamination de la rivière de Morlaix par les métaux ArchiMer
Boutier, Bernard; Chiffoleau, Jean-francois; Gonzalez, Jean-louis; Noel, Joelle.
Raw and processed outflow from the Morlaix city sewage treatment plant were monitored every fourth hour for a 24 hours period, and monthly for eight months. The urban Hg, Cd, Cu, Zn and Pb outflow was shown to be much less than the river-borne flux. Sediments from the catchment area and estuary show that the influence of the town on the metal concentrations is limited to the harbour basin. The metal concentations are essentially controlled by granulometry.

L'utilisation des échantillonneurs passifs. Une nouvelle méthode pour évaluer la contamination chimique des masses d'eau ArchiMer
Gourlay, Catherine; Gonzalez, Jean-louis.
The Water European Framework Directive requires the implementation of programs to monitor the chemical quality of water bodies (freshwater, transition water and seawater), based on grab measurements of concentrations of various contaminants (metals, organic compounds). The results are limited by several analytical difficulties, and the poor representativity because of the temporal variability of contamination. The passive sampling techniques, which basically consist of concentrating substances on a submerged device for a given period, and analyzing accumulated substances, should improve the monitoring, by simplifying analytical issues (lower detection limits, analysis in a simpler matrix), and allowing time integration of the contamination. Metal measurement in aquatic environments by passive sampling methods: Lessons learning from an in situ intercomparison exercise ArchiMer
Dabrin, A.; Ghestem, J. -p.; Uher, E.; Gonzalez, Jean-louis; Allan, I. J.; Schintu, M.; Montero, N.; Balaam, J.; Peinerud, E.; Miege, C.; Coquery, M..
Passive sampling devices (PS) are widely used for pollutant monitoring in water, but estimation of measurement uncertainties by PS has seldom been undertaken. The aim of this work was to identify key parameters governing PS measurements of metals and their dispersion. We report the results of an in situ intercomparison exercise on diffusive gradient in thin films (DGT) in surface waters. Interlaboratory uncertainties of time-weighted average (TWA) concentrations were satisfactory (from 28% to 112%) given the number of participating laboratories (10) and ultra-trace metal concentrations involved.
